Treadmill shops generally use a series of alternatives. Comprehending the type of treadmill that best at home treadmill matches your requirements can streamline the shopping procedure:
Manual Treadmills: These treadmills do not have a motor; rather, they rely on the user's effort to move the belt. They are normally less pricey and more compact, making them ideal for those with limited area.

Folding Treadmills: Designed for simple storage, these treadmills can be folded up when not in use. They are ideal for small home.
Business Treadmills: Built for heavy usage, these treadmills are frequently discovered in fitness centers and gym. They are created for toughness and performance but can be more expensive.
Hybrid Treadmills: These models combine functions of both treadmills and other fitness machines, such as a rowing machine or elliptical, supplying a more versatile workout.

When it comes to purchasing a treadmill, various shopping alternatives are offered:
Local Fitness Stores: Visiting a regional fitness devices store allows buyers to evaluate out treadmills direct and get personalized assistance from knowledgeable personnel.
Big-Box Retailers: Stores like Walmart and Target provide treadmills at competitive rates, but the selection might be limited compared to specialized shops.
Online Retailers: Websites like Amazon and specialized fitness equipment sites frequently have extensive selections and user evaluations to assist purchasers make notified decisions.
Secondhand Market: Consider inspecting platforms like Craigslist or Facebook Marketplace for used treadmills. However, it's necessary to examine them for any damage or wear.
Brand Websites: Brands like NordicTrack and Bowflex frequently offer treadmills directly through their websites, offering exclusive offers and service warranties.
